Every girl has that one crush. The one she never spoke to, yet built entire worlds with inside her head. The one whose smile she memorized from across the street, whose voice she replayed in silence. He was mine—my neighbor’s cousin, the boy who never knew I existed. Back then, I thought love was about fairytales and fate. But real life? It has a way of moving on even when your heart doesn’t. He left—for school, then for another country—and I learned to live without the sound of his laughter in the air. Years passed. The crush faded… or at least I thought it did. Until tonight. My life had finally found peace—quiet, steady, simple. And then he walked in. Like a storm I didn’t see coming. Same eyes. Same careless charm. And suddenly, all those years of silence weren’t enough to drown the echo of his name. Maybe some people never really leave our stories. They just wait for the right chapter to return.

Chapter 1

I’m Riya —cheerful, adventurous, and usually the first one to crack a joke in the room. At home, I’m a whirlwind of energy, always planning small adventures or teasing my parents. To relatives, I’m the calm, composed one who listens politely, smiles warmly, and only occasionally lets my playful side peek out.

My parents are my pillars. Mom, Sreedevi, is a school teacher, gentle, caring, and forever fussing over details, from my clothes to my breakfast. Dad, Rajesh, works as an IT manager, and he’s the perfect mix of strict and fun—always teasing me, but the first to back me up if I need him. Together, they’ve given me the freedom to explore, make mistakes, and still know I have a safe place to come home to.

I live for my friends almost as much as my family. My best friend, Ruchitha, has been my partner-in-crime since college. She’s bubbly, dramatic, and the only person who can match my energy. Then there’s Vinod, playful, mischievous, and a little annoying at times—but somehow, he balances out our chaos perfectly. With them, I’m loud, talkative, and occasionally unstoppable.

To my extended family, I’m a mix of both worlds. With aunts, uncles, and cousins, I’m calm, polite, and respectful, making sure I don’t cross any boundaries. But with close cousins, I’m back to my adventurous self—daring dares, teasing, and planning small fun escapades whenever possible.

I love mornings—there’s something about the sunrise that calls me out, coffee in hand, watching the world wake up. I love laughter, small adventures, and talking endlessly about anything and everything with the people I care about.

And yes, I sometimes drive my parents crazy with my energy, but they know it’s all love. Life, to me, is about moving forward, making memories, and enjoying every laugh along the way.

So, here I am—Riya M. Adventurous, talkative, endlessly curious, and completely ready to dive into Ruchitha’s wedding chaos, armed with laughter, mischief, and maybe a few little surprises of my own.
